Engaging in responsible business strategies offers significant benefits that surpass a gesture of goodwill and push a business into long-term prosperity. Among the most perceptible benefits that shows the importance of corporate social responsibility is the improvement of a brand's reputation. This is induced by enhancing trust and transparency among both consumers and stakeholders. This also has favorable impacts on worker attitude and engagement, making employees feel more inspired and loyal to a company that mirrors their individual values. Additionally, in today's social climate, consumers are more aware of worldly issues and the effects of specific business disciplines. Corporate social responsibility (CSR) incorporates a large range of practices where businesses are voluntarily providing contributions to the betterment of both society and a cleaner environment. Though there are many types of corporate social responsibility, there are a couple of key areas of relevance that both companies and stakeholders have been taking into account. One of the most significant areas of attention is environmental obligation. This is encouraging companies to adopt more sustainable business practices and pay attention to their ecological footprint. Likewise, ethical responsibility involves the congruity of behaviours that are centred around fairness, sincerity and righteousness. Additionally, philanthropic responsibility has encouraged companies to give back to the community, including options to donate and volunteer as a means of sponsoring local initiatives.
